1. Early Education and Career

Bailey Da Costa's foundational knowledge in engineering equipped him for his future endeavors. He studied Electrical and Electronics Engineering at Caltech, which provided him a strong background in technical skills such as MATLAB and Python. Before co-founding OutSail Shipping, Da Costa contributed to various forward-thinking projects, including roles at Impossible Aerospace and AEye, Inc., where he honed skills that are pivotal today in advancing maritime innovation.

2. Founding OutSail Shipping

Co-founded in 2022 by Bailey Da Costa, OutSail Shipping aims to transform maritime transportation through innovative technology. OutSail Shipping integrates aerodynamics used in aerospace to create retractable wingsails for container ships. This venture was backed by the prominent Y Combinator accelerator, highlighting its potential and credibility in the tech and startup ecosystems.

3. OutSail's Innovative Technology

OutSail Shipping's core innovation lies in its fully autonomous, retractable wingsails. Unlike traditional shipping methods reliant on costly fossil fuels, these sails offer an eco-friendly alternative that reduces both emissions and operational costs. The wingsails utilize modern aerodynamics, which harness wind power more efficiently, thus making them a sustainable choice for the maritime industry.

4. Environmental Impact

The shipping industry is a significant contributor to global carbon emissions, accounting for approximately 3% of worldwide emissions annually. Da Costa’s OutSail provides a critical solution to this environmental challenge by designing wind-powered vessels that are expected to significantly reduce these emissions. The transition from traditional fuel-dependent shipping to wind-powered methods is essential in facilitating global environmental goals.

5. Economic Advantages

Beyond environmental benefits, OutSail’s technology addresses the economic strain of rising fuel costs. Ships powered by OutSail's innovative wingsails present reduced fuel expenditure by over 50%, thus providing a viable economic alternative to traditional ocean freight. This cost-effectiveness is crucial as shipping demand is projected to double by 2050.

7. Future Prospects

As demand for environmentally sustainable solutions grows, OutSail is poised to expand its impact globally. The company aims to extend its technology across maritime freight routes worldwide, beginning with routes between the US West Coast and Hawaii. This initiative will potentially reshape the future of maritime shipping, contributing further to global sustainability efforts.
